
Shark Reef Aquarium at Mandalay Bay
One of the largest aquariums in the country — sharks, rays, sea turtles, a Komodo dragon, and nearly 2 million gallons of water. On the Strip, great for all ages.
Shark Reef at Mandalay Bay packs more than 2,000 animals and nearly 2 million gallons of water into an immersive walk-through aquarium experience. You'll come face-to-face with sharks (over 100 of them), giant rays, endangered green sea turtles, piranha, a Komodo dragon, and more exotic species than most families will know what to name.
Open daily 10am–6pm (last admission 5pm). The aquarium now includes an Undersea Explorer VR experience — a 36-seat motion-platform theater that takes you swimming with humpback whales or tiger sharks. VR is for ages 5 and up.
